![]() ![]() On June 13 in Greensboro, N.C., Lyons will participate in the New Balance Nationals Outdoor meet.Īfter that meet, Lyons will get a summer to breathe. The rookie’s season is not quite over yet, either. “It feels so great knowing I made it to this level.” She wasn’t totally satisfied with her performance, but she was proud to be the only freshman in the 36-runner field. Lyons placed ninth in the 800-meter run with a time of 2:16.76. Her sterling freshman campaign continued on June 8 at Northern Burlington County Regional High School in Columbus, in the NJSIAA Meet of Champions. This spring, she also won the NJSIAA Central Jersey, Group 3 sectional championship in the 800-meter run on May 25 at Jackson Liberty High School. In the winter, she qualified for the New Balance Nationals Indoor meet on March 8 in New York City. “No one touched it in 21 years but a freshman in her first year knocked it out.” “That was pretty awesome for a freshman,” said Allentown coach Rick Smith. The previous record had stood for 21 years. She placed ninth in the event but set the Redbirds’ new program mark. On May 31 at Central Regional, the freshman finished the 400-meter dash in 58.15. The record was 2:20.00 going into the season.Īnd that was not even the only record Lyons broke at the state group meet. With the time of 2:13.98, Lyons broke Allentown’s program record for the 800-meter run for the fourth time this spring. ![]()
